Manuscript Plagiarism Detection
AI can enhance manuscript plagiarism detection by analyzing large volumes of text for similarities and discrepancies. Tools like Turnitin utilize AI algorithms to identify potential instances of copied content in academic papers. This technology can reduce the chances of unintentional plagiarism, promoting originality in research submissions. Institutions such as universities may benefit from adopting AI-driven solutions to maintain the integrity of their publication processes.

Predictive Citation Analytics
AI usage in scientific publishing, particularly through predictive citation analytics, offers researchers a chance to enhance their work's visibility. This technology assesses past citation patterns to forecast future impacts, potentially guiding authors in choosing publication venues. For instance, journals like Nature might benefit from employing such analytics to attract high-impact articles. By leveraging these insights, researchers can increase their chances of citation and collaboration, ultimately strengthening their academic influence.
